Class ExpressionData

WyrażenieDane

Dane wyrażenia używane do oceny wyrażenia

Dostępne tylko w ramach programu Gemini Alpha w przypadku dodatków do Google Workspace, które rozszerzają Google Workspace Flows.

const expressionData = CardService.newExpressionData();

Metody

MetodaZwracany typKrótki opis
addCondition(condition)ExpressionDataDodaje warunek do bieżących danych wyrażenia.
addEventAction(eventAction)ExpressionDataDodaje działanie związane z wydarzeniem do bieżących danych wyrażenia.
setExpression(expression)ExpressionDataUstawia wartość danych wyrażenia.
setId(id)ExpressionDataUstawia identyfikator danych wyrażenia.

Szczegółowa dokumentacja

addCondition(condition)

Dodaje warunek do bieżących danych wyrażenia.

Parametry

NazwaTypOpis
conditionConditionWarunek do dodania.

Powrót

ExpressionData – ten obiekt ExpressionData do łączenia.


addEventAction(eventAction)

Dodaje działanie związane z wydarzeniem do bieżących danych wyrażenia.

Parametry

NazwaTypOpis
eventActionEventActionDziałanie EventAction do dodania.

Powrót

ExpressionData – ten obiekt ExpressionData do łączenia.


setExpression(expression)

Ustawia wartość danych wyrażenia.

Parametry

NazwaTypOpis
expressionStringNieskompilowane wyrażenie CEL.

Powrót

ExpressionData – ten obiekt ExpressionData do łączenia.


setId(id)

Ustawia identyfikator danych wyrażenia.

Parametry

NazwaTypOpis
idStringUnikalny identyfikator ExpressionData.

Powrót

ExpressionData – ten obiekt ExpressionData do łączenia.